DOT’S LITTLE FOLK.

Dot invites short letters from her young friends throughout the Dominion on matters of interest to themselves, the result of their observations in the animal world, doscriptions of anything they are interested in, of the district in which they live, of their school and homo lite, holiday trips, &o. The letters are to bo written by the little folk themselves, and addressed “Dot, caro of Editor Witness.”
